In 1805, Joseph Marie Jacquard, a French service provider, developed the primary methodology to automate textile looms. He would use punch cards with pre-recorded entries and use them sequentially to standardize operation. His loom was successful and was adopted throughout France, thus marking the primary commercialization of an automatic machine. The lowered prices and easy operation of this textile loom drove others to progressively apply punch cards to quite a lot of functions, from shifting levers to telegraphy.
